Truly Madly Guilty Book Review

Truly Madly Guilty - Liane Moriarty

This is my first Liane Moriarty book and I wasn't really impressed. I thought the majority of it was fairly boring. The climactic part is supposed the be the barbecue which the entire time we have no idea what happened. And once we get to that point I felt totally let down....

 

Three couples were at a barbecue one day when clearly disaster struck. But the question is what happened and why did affect each of these couples so deeply? Switching between characters and before and after the barbecue we slowly get to piece together the puzzle pieces and find out just what happened. 

 

This is definitely full of characterization, the problem is, unlike Emily Griffin books, I didn't care much for the characters. I found most of the woman obnoxious especially since I listened to it. 

 

Not my favorite book out there but I'm willing to give other Moriarty books a try.
